Early Life and Education

Alexander Braverman was born on June 8, 1974, in Moscow, Russia. From a young age, he showed a keen interest in mathematics and excelled in his studies. He went on to pursue a degree in mathematics at Moscow State University, where he graduated with top honors.

Professional Career

After completing his education, Alexander Braverman began his professional career as a mathematician. He worked at various research institutions in Russia before moving to Israel to join the prestigious Tel Aviv University.

Contributions to Mathematics

Throughout his career, Alexander Braverman has made significant contributions to the field of mathematics. His research focuses on algebraic geometry, representation theory, and mathematical physics. He has published numerous papers in top-tier journals and has received several awards for his work.

Algebraic Geometry

One of Alexander Braverman’s key contributions to algebraic geometry is his work on the theory of motives. Motives are a fundamental concept in algebraic geometry that encode information about geometric objects. Braverman’s work has shed light on the structure of motives and their connections to other areas of mathematics.

Representation Theory

In the field of representation theory, Alexander Braverman has made significant advances in the study of quantum groups. Quantum groups are algebraic structures that generalize the symmetries of quantum systems. Braverman’s work has deepened our understanding of these structures and their applications in physics and mathematics.

Mathematical Physics

Alexander Braverman’s research in mathematical physics has focused on the intersection of geometry and physics. He has developed new techniques for studying geometric objects that arise in physical theories, such as gauge theories and string theory. His work has led to new insights into the nature of space-time and the fundamental forces of nature.
